About 4812 Plum St
When did 4812 Plum St, North Charleston, SC last sell?
4812 Plum St, North Charleston, SC last sold on Jan 2, 2001, according to the county's recorded deed.
What schools serve 4812 Plum St, North Charleston, SC?
4812 Plum St, North Charleston, SC is assigned to Meeting Street Brentwood (elementary); North Charleston High School (high), rated F. All sit in Charleston County School District. Attendance boundaries change — confirm with the district before relying on an assignment.
What are the property taxes on 4812 Plum St, North Charleston, SC?
The 2024 property tax bill for 4812 Plum St, North Charleston, SC was $1,084. The county assessed it at $3,480.
